ZIP Code 11766 - Mount Sinai Map and Data

Description

In the metro area surrounding Metro New York City, ZIP Code 11766 is found in the state of New York. Suffolk County is the primary location of ZIP code 11766. MOUNT SINAI, New York is the designation given to the area code 11766 by the US Postal Service. Port Jefferson Station, NY, Miller Place, NY, Coram, Port Jefferson, NY, Terryville, NY, and portions of ZIP code 11766 are located in or border these cities. The ZIP code 11766 is under the 631 area code. In comparison to other zipcodes in New York, 11766 can be categorised socioeconomically as a Middle Class class.

The current unemployment rate in 11766 is 2.3%, which is lower than the county’s current rate of 4.3%, the state’s current rate of 3.6%, and the current rate of 3.7% for the entire country.

The population of 11766 grew to 12635 from 9365 according to the 2010 US Census. White people make up the majority of both the population in 11766 and the students enrolled in its public schools. 5.3% of students in 11766 public schools participate in free or reduced lunch programmes or are eligible to do so.
